9 LITERARY ACTIVITIES MOST important part of the activities was played by the two literary societies the Kel Lydi- ans and Zeto Sophians. At the beginning of the year representatives of the two societies 'met and divided the new students. Then the fight Was on! The so- cieties gave programs alternately on Saturday evens ings each striving to give a better entertainment than the other. The programs were mostly of a humorous nature with a little seriousness mixed in and a good list of music produced by our gifted students All this provided a change and rest from the concentra- tion in the class room. The debating Club consi.ting of some ten mem- bers was organized in October Three of these were chosen to represent the School in the Missouri Debatg ing League. The question for the year wasi Re- solved: A Federal Department ,of Education should be created with a'Secretary in the President's Cabi- net. T Our team had the negative side of the debate and lost both to Crane and to Rogersville. Other de- bates among the students at various times Werejboth amusing and instructive. r T S j During the latter part of the year each Senior was required to lead chapel. A few of them had been 'in front of an audience before and took to the stage like a duck to water, but a majority of them had to brace themselves against the trusty radiator and force their husky voices to repeat the sentences they had written on the notes. r V CHOOL o TH ozARKs 3 THE KEL LYDAH LITERARY SOCIETY The Kel Lydians are very fortunate in hav- ing some of the splendid talent of the school in their membership. And as a result their programs are very interesting. To them was given the distinction of pre- senting the first program in the Auditorium of the new Administration building. This Was a most enjoyable little one act play, which was made much more effective by having a real stage and setting. It is the aim of the Kel Lydians to use not the same talent over and over againg but to devel- ope all the embryonic musicians, actors, lectur- ers and debaters.
